Bookook Securities said Thursday that CEO Park Hyun-chul has joined a relay campaign to eradicate illegal gambling among youth.

Park participated in the campaign upon a relay nomination from Yun Chang-hyun, president of Koscom. He nominated Geum Jeong-ho, CEO of Shinyoung Securities, and Gwak Bong-seok, CEO of DB Financial Investment, as the next relay participants.

The campaign is a society-wide initiative organized by the Seoul Metropolitan Police Agency to raise awareness of the need for crime prevention. It was launched to heighten public vigilance over the growing problem of illegal gambling among youth, which has been spreading primarily through online platforms.

"Illegal gambling among youth is an important issue that must be addressed as a society," Park said. "We will fulfill our social responsibility for the safe and healthy future of young people, and I hope this campaign will help eradicate illegal gambling among youth."
